If you are using the cream cheese to cook something (like cheesecake) keep in mind that some cream cheeses in containers are the "whipped" kind, therefore are lighter and do not work well in baked recipes. For recipes requiring melted cream cheese, note that low-fat and nonfat varieties will not melt as well as regular cream cheese. Because of the lower fat content, there are more emulsifiers and stabilizers which inhibit melting. If you are baking then it is easier to cut 1/4 or 1/2 of a block of cream cheese.
